Essential Blues Guitar Lessons [24 of 27] Electric Blues For Intermediates

As we move into the second part of the solo, we move positions on the fretboard. We are now using the pentatonic box 3 and 4 (3 in minor and 4 in major). These are some truly classic blues style licks, so try to really focus on when you are using the major, when minor, and when you are neatly blending the two.
